View some art

Khawla Art Gallery in d3 has launched its first-ever Summer Collective, showcasing various works from emerging and established artists. The artists displaying their work include Abdelkrim Mancer, Ahlam Ismail, Amal Salloum, Fafi Balhawan and Nidal Khaddour. Featuring miniature paintings, upcycled art, oil and acrylic paintings, calligraphy, and charcoal drawings, their pieces promise to captivate and inspire others choosing to tread the same path of expressionism.

Escape reality

If you thought Avatar was impressive, then get ready to be wowed by Aya, an immersive, experiential entertainment park in Wafi City Mall. Combining art with state-of-the-art technology, it features 12 zones spread across 40,000 square feet where visitors can enjoy different experiences, each with its own unique theme and interactive elements. Experiences include observatories packed with a million stars, gardens of blooming light, and a river of colour that generates storms and pools.

Dine at Din Tai Fung

Din Tai Fung has a loyal following across the world. Sure, it’s a chain, but it’s a brilliant one. What started as a small shop in Taipei has earned a MICHELIN star in Hong Kong and become a global culinary sensation across the world, from London to Sydney. The restaurant has just opened its latest location at Dubai Hills Mall, where you can experience those world-famous handmade dumplings, baos, buns, noodles, shumai, soups and wontons. Plus, there’s a private dining room.

Try Dubai’s viral chocolate bar

In the UAE, kunafa is a beloved dessert, and Fix Dessert Chocolatier has taken it up a notch with their viral Kunafa Chocolate Bar. Combining gooey kunafa mixture with rich chocolate, this treat is a blend of chocolatey and cheesy goodness that you won’t want to miss. The kunafa’s sweetness pairs perfectly with the decadent chocolate, creating a blend of textures and flavours. Fun fact: These chocolates from the UAE have now become a global sensation.
